District: University Heights Cs (8065)
Operating Type Charter Pupils
County: Essex
Operating Type Charter Pupils Summary:

State Level Summary:
Total Spending Per Pupil (Definition)
2016-17 Total Spending: $13,201,962
2016-17 Average Daily Enroll plus Sent Pupils: 631
2016-17 Costs Amount per Pupil: $20,929
2017-18 Total Spending: $16,728,732
2017-18 Average Daily Enroll plus Sent Pupils: 749
2017-18 Costs Amount per Pupil: $22,326
Summary of Vital Statistics (Definition)
2017-18 Total Spending Per Pupil: $22,326
Revenue Sources, State: 85.1%
Revenue Sources, Local Taxes: 10.6%
Revenue Sources, Federal: 4.3%
Revenue Sources, Tuition: 0
Revenue Sources, Use of Fund Balance: 0
Revenue Sources, Other: 0
Fall 2017 Certified Staff:
  Student/Teacher Ratio: 11.2
  Student/Support Ratio: 124.8
  Student/Administrator Ratio: 124.8
10/15/18 % of Classified Students to Total Students: 9.34%
